Google Cast App Officially Rebranded to Google Home; Gets Brand New Logo and Interface

Google Cast app users started getting notifications earlier this month saying that the app will be re-branded in the following weeks. Now, the transition is complete and the search giant seems to have completely revamped its casting app with the new name - Google Home - and a new design. While the updated app is now rolling out for Android, the iOS app is yet to be re-branded from Google Cast.

This is the second occasion that the app has been re-branded by Google. It was earlier named Chromecast app, before being named Google Cast app by the company. However, the changes to the app don't end at just the name. The Google Home app has a redesigned user interface with introduction of new tabs and removal of old ones.

Instead of the three tabs 'What's On', 'Devices', and 'Get Apps' that were earlier present, the revamped app has just two tabs namely 'Watch' and 'Discover'. The search bar has now been removed but users can perform search using the 'search icon' at the bottom right of the screen.

The most noticeable change coming with the Google Home update is to the icon, which now looks like a home and has all the primary Google colours in it.

It is not a coincidence that the app's name now bears resemblance to the company's Google Home speaker, which is competitor to Amazon's Echo, as Google is aiming to create a single hub for all Chromecast devices. Notably, Apple also brought its HomeKit-enabled services under single app recently, called Apple Holme.

As with every major update, the updated Google Home app is expected to reach users in phases. The India app store is still showing the Google Cast app. Those impatient for the updated app can download and sideload it via APK Mirror.
